Ich verwende manchmal das Git-Bash-Terminal, das mit der Github-App für Windows geliefert wird, um mich per SSH mit meinen Webservern zu verbinden. Dies ist ganz einfach durch Ausführen von
ssh user@myhost
und geben Sie das Passwort ein.
In Unix-Systemen gibt es normalerweise eine config
Datei im ~/.ssh
Verzeichnis, in der Sie Ihre gespeicherten Hosts und alle Optionen platzieren können, beispielsweise eine Schlüsseldatei für den passwortlosen Zugriff.
Gibt es ein Äquivalent bei der Verwendung von Git Bash oder muss ich meine SSH-Befehle immer manuell erstellen?
Antwort1
Die Antwort ist, dass es genau gleich funktioniert.
Fügen Sie eine config
Datei in einem .ssh
Ordner im Home-Verzeichnis hinzu und füllen Sie sie mit den gespeicherten Hosts.
Um den Zugriff mit öffentlichen Schlüsseln zuzulassen, müssen Sie lediglich den öffentlichen Schlüssel Ihres PCs zur authorized
Schlüsseldatei auf dem Server hinzufügen, bei dem Sie sich anmelden möchten. Die GitHub-App erstellt normalerweise bei der Installation im Ordner .ssh ein Schlüsselpaar für Sie, oder Sie können mithilfe von ein neues erstellen ssh-keygen
.